> The kit utilizes a novel interface with the aircraft’s flight controls and mission systems, allowing a pilot to toggle between traditional human control and AI control with the flip of a switch. This ensures a safe, reliable environment for human-on-the-loop experimentation. How, exactly, does that ensure a safe reliable environment? Humans are pretty bad at suddenly taking over when an automatic system reaches its…

It doesn't, flying these is potentially very dangerous, there are many non-recoverable situations. But AFRL/NASA has been working on this for decades. The manoeuvres the higher level AI requests are actioned by highly assured dynamical systems solvers using model predictive control, like the autopilot, that maintain the aircraft in the safe envelope.

The unknowns in this system are (a) how agressive is the flight controller? (b) how clever is the autonomy?

That is underestimating it. DARPA already showed dogfighting that can beat humans in simulation, and they may allow this do execute that.

However, dogfighting isn't very interesting, all combat occurs BVR and in the RF/EW domain.

Pilots are already spending most of their time thinking about epistemic problems: can I see my opponent, can they see me, how do I deceive, am I being deceived, how do I avoid being detected/tracked/targeted/engaged, while possibly trying to do that to everything else. AI is not yet very good at that.
